<snip some good advice and some open source advocacy> The nVidia forum suggests disabling DRI Because the standard X DRI module conflicts with the nVidia driver and because the standard DRI module is not needed by the nVidia driver for direct rendering. To download and install the drivers, follow the steps below: STEP 1: Review the NVIDIA Software License. You will need to accept this license prior to downloading any files. When emailing linux-b...@nvidia.com, please attach an nvidia-bug-report.log, which is generated by running "nvidia-bug-report.sh".
